Newspaper Digging For Dirt

March 31st, 2008 by Will Prusik in News, PC

Have endless hours of playing video games left you a bloodthirsty amoral beast hell-bent on rending human flesh and destroying countless lives in your wake? It seems that somebody is hoping that’s the case. They’re also hoping you’ll tell your story for cash. A national newspaper in the United Kingdom has taken out an advertisement on StarNow (a website that advertises opportunities for hopeful actors) offering hundreds of pounds to the ‘right person’. The post asks for you to “write a few lines about how computer games turned you to crime”. This sounds like a wonderful opportunity for somebody to make video games a scapegoat in order to pay off legal fees, or maybe just the poorest excuse for journalistic research there’s ever been.
